Cost of Dirt Grading in Spokane

When considering the cost of dirt grading in Spokane, WA, it's essential to understand the various factors that influence the overall expense. Dirt grading is a crucial step in many construction and landscaping projects, ensuring a level base and proper drainage. Whether you're preparing for a new building, driveway, or garden, knowing the costs involved can help you budget effectively.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Area: Larger areas require more time and resources to grade, increasing the overall cost.
  • Soil Type: Different soil types, such as clay or sandy soil, can affect the difficulty and cost of grading.
  • Slope of the Land: Steeper slopes require more work to level, impacting the cost.
  • Accessibility: Easy access to the site can lower costs, while difficult access can increase them.
  • Permits and Regulations: Local permits and regulations may add to the cost of the project.
  • Equipment Needed: The type and amount of equipment required can influence the cost.
  • Labor Costs: Labor rates in Spokane, WA, can vary, affecting the total expense.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Spokane, WA)
Basic Land Grading $1,500 - $3,000
Driveway Grading $1,000 - $2,500
Foundation Grading $2,000 - $4,500
Landscape Grading $1,200 - $2,800
Slope Grading $2,500 - $5,000
Soil Testing and Analysis $300 - $700
